If they are organic members (not purchased) then I suggest don't sell your groups. It's really difficult to build an online community. In addition to what others have mentioned, you can use fb groups to:
1. Test out new ideas for products & services
2. Sell your own products & educational content
3. Do affiliate marketing
4. Launch industry events on your groups, for others (for a price)

Instead of seeing it as a group, think of your FB group as a high-traffic platform that you can lease to others to sell their product, content and do other marketing activities.
